Chapter 754
Third Person’s POV
Adelaide managed a choked–up “Mhm” in response.

She bit her lower lip hard, struggling for a few seconds just to find her voice. “I’ll… I’ll send someone to the city guard post to see if Lance is back. Go inside and get some hot tea; warm up a bit. Paisley, look after Lisa for me, okay?”
With that, she turned and bolted toward the estate gates, as if staying near those crates of gifts would physically burn her.
Lisa watched Adelaide vanish into the dark, her own eyes swimming with tears. Leaning on Paisley, she stumbled slightly–looking like the stress of the border had aged her ten years in a single night–and slowly made her way into the manor.
Adelaide stood out in the freezing wind for a long time. She let the biting air sting her eyes until the heat faded from them, then she finally wiped her face and headed back inside.
By the time she reached the living room, Lisa had pulled herself together. She was sitting by the fire, peppering Paisley with questions about how Adelaide had been doing.
When Lisa heard that Alpha Zander was safe at his own manor under house arrest, and that Adelaide and Lance had already snuck in to see him, she finally let out a breath she’d been holding since the border.
Seeing Adelaide walk back in–back straight, boots clicking, wearing that sharp midnight–black uniform–Lisa beamed with pride. Her girl hadn’t just grown up; she’d used her claws and fangs to carve out a legend for herself in a military world completely dominated by Alphas.
Lisa gestured for her to sit, pushing the heavy gift talk aside for a moment. “Come sit. Paisley’s been telling me all about your exploits. Tell me, are you really running the capital’s elite forces now? Is it as easy as you make it look?”
Adelaide walked over and dropped into a nearby armchair, her chin lifting with a spark of her old attitude. “It’s a blast. If anyone gives me trouble, I just beat them until they listen.”
Ever since the massacre, she’d rarely spoken like that. Usually, she was as cold and hard as a block of ice. But right now, she wanted Lisa to see the old Adelaide–the one who was loud, vibrant, and a total handful.
Lisa laughed heartily and reached over to ruffle her hair. “Good! A young she–wolf like you should be living life on her own terms.”
Adelaide leaned her head onto Lisa’s shoulder. Up close, she realized just how much the woman had aged. The thick, dark hair Lisa used to be so proud of was now heavily streaked with silver.
Adelaide remembered the last time she’d seen her before the war; Lisa only had a few gray hairs then, and she’d been obsessed with hiding them with expensive dyes. Now, the silver was everywhere, and Lisa clearly didn’t care anymore.
Lisa’s heart ached for the girl struggling in this den of vipers, but Adelaide felt the same for her. The endless shelling, the freezing winds of the border, and the daily torture of waiting for the casualty lists had stripped the vanity away from the once–glamorous socialite.
Lisa wiped her eyes and patted Adelaide’s shoulder. “I heard Priscilla is staying here too. I should go pay my respects.”
Adelaide snapped out of it, knocking her knuckles against her forehead. “Look at my brain–I got so excited I forgot the basics, Come on, let’s go.”

Priscilla actually knew Lisa had arrived the moment she stepped onto the property. She’d stayed in her room to give them space for their reunion, even telling the staff she’d skip dinner in the main hall.
But before long, Adelaide and Paisley brought Lisa to her sitting room. Priscilla was impressed; she liked that Lisa, a high–born she- wolf, still followed the old–school rules of etiquette even after a long journey.
